# #720c73

A color — cool, vivid, dark, technical, modern, luxury, bold. Deterministic analysis from BrandSweets (no inference).

## Values

- Hex: `#720c73`
- RGB: rgb(114, 12, 115)
- HSL: hsl(299, 81%, 25%)
- OKLCH: oklch(0.393 0.172 327.8)
- Relative luminance: 0.0508
- Nearest named color: purple (#800080, Δ 3.521) — https://brandsweets.com/colors/purple
- Moods: cool, vivid, dark, technical, modern, luxury, bold

##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 10.42: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A pass
- On black (#000000): 2.02:1 — AA fail, AA-large fail,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#cd16d0 (4.62:1); AA: background → #ababab (4.54:1); AAA: text → #eb54ed (7.02:1); AAA: background → #d4d4d4 (7.03:1)
